Rennet Pudding Recipe
Yield: 4 servingsRecipe by luhu.jp
Ingredients:
2 cup: Milk,
2 tsp: Brandy,
2 tsp: Sugar,
Cinnamon,
1 tsp: Rennet,
Nutmeg,
Directions:
From the Joy of Cooking: "This favorite English dish is made of milk,
coagulated with extract from the lining of unweaned calves
stomachs.It has a consistency much like that of a tender blanc-mange"
[cornstarch or almond milk with gelatin pudding].
Put into a bowl in which it will be served, the milk warmed to
exactly 98 deg F, add the sugar, rennet and brandy. Let stand 1 1/2
hrs to coagulate and sprinkle with the spices.
